The locations for the 2025 Ovens and King Football Netball League finals series have been unveiled.

For the first two weeks of finals, played across the weekend on Saturday and Sunday, matches will be split between North Wangaratta Recreation Reserve and Whorouly Recreation Reserve.

Saturday games, on 23 and 30 August, will be played at North Wangaratta, while the matches on Sunday, 24 and 31 August, will be played at Whorouly.

Preliminary finals will be at North Wangaratta on Saturday, 6 September, while the grand final remains at W. J. Findlay Oval in Wangaratta on 13 September.

It marks the third change in as many seasons regarding when and where the finals are played.

O&K FNL operations manager Daniel Saville said the league was keen to change it up and trial finals at different locations.

“It’s something we look at and review every year, and we went in the direction of trialling a new finals venue,” he said.

“Tarrawingee has such a long and successful history of hosting finals, but we wanted to see what else we have in the community, and Whorouly has some amazing facilities,

“We’ll trial it this year, and we’re sure it’s going to go well, but there’s nothing stopping us from reviewing or looking at other venues in the next couple of years.

“Whorouly has some brilliant facilities, football and netball - yes, it is a little bit further from the city of Wangaratta, but the other finals venues are in Wangaratta, so I’d hope it wouldn’t make too much of a difference for attending patrons.”

Whorouly FNC president Eddie Costenaro said the club was thrilled to throw open its doors for finals for the first time since the 2009 season.

“Daniel [Saville] rang me a while ago, after the first game, he came down and saw how good the ground and facilities were,” he said.

“We’ve been working pretty hard over the last few years to get it all up to standard - we’ve got one of the best grounds and with the new netball courts, state of the art courts, the facilities are all good.

“With everybody’s hard work, it’s good to be appreciated

“We’ve got a perfect ground, a perfect venue, so hopefully everybody will enjoy it.”

While Costenaro acknowledged parking space around the recreation reserve could be a potential limiting factor, plans are in place to accommodate the expected crowds who will flock to witness finals football and netball.

The 2025 Ovens and King finals series commences on the weekend of 23-24 August.
